I love and always will love the champagne brunch at the Wynn....It has an amazing selection of food. Everything from sushi (very standard, but still good), Chinese dim sum (I've been VERY pleased with the rice noodles and dumplings I've had here) to salads, breakfast, carving stations and more.
Some of the food is less amazing then others, but it's worth it for the variety. And, of course, for the homemade gelato and amazing fruit and pastries.

If you want a high-quality buffet with a wide variety, then the Wynn is your choice. I've had buffets at every major casino multiple times and the Wynn remains my top pick. Maybe it's because I'm a sucker for their eclectic selection of dishes ranging from Asian to Italian to the typical seafood and prime rib cut options. I even think their coffee tastes better. Do know that you will pay a penalty in the wait (it's long) and the price (it's more expensive than the other buffets). You get what you pay for, kids.
